Concrete Issues & Repair Insights in Alpine

Short summers and long freeze seasons compress the window for concrete work to just a few months, so fast-curing repair methods get priority. Rocky subgrade with poor drainage traps snowmelt beneath slabs, slowly displacing finer soil particles and leaving gaps. Driveway aprons crack where they meet the garage, and snowmelt pooling at the transition accelerates settlement every spring. Cooler temperatures don't slow foam leveling the way they slow cement slurry, which is a real advantage where the repair season runs from May to October.

What Is Commercial Slab Leveling?

How commercial slab leveling works for Alpine homeowners.

Commercial slab leveling raises settled concrete in warehouses, loading docks, retail spaces, and other commercial properties. Minimizes downtime and restores safe, level surfaces for foot traffic, forklifts, and equipment. It typically costs 50 to 70% less than tearing out and repouring, with same-day results on most jobs.

How Much Does Commercial Slab Leveling Cost in Alpine?

What to expect when budgeting for commercial slab leveling in Alpine, WY.

Commercial Slab Leveling in Alpine typically costs $3 to $10 per square foot, or $500 to $3,000 for a typical residential project. The exact price depends on the slab size, the amount of settlement, and how easy it is to access the area.

Commercial Slab Leveling estimate range in Alpine: roughly $3 to $10 per sq ft, or about $500 to $3,000 for many residential jobs.

These are general estimates, not fixed quotes for Alpine. Final pricing depends on slab size, settlement depth, access, and method selection.

Most homeowners in Alpine spend between $500 and $2,500 on a leveling project. The final price depends on the number of slabs, how far they've settled, and which method the contractor uses.

Polyurethane foam injection tends to cost a bit more than traditional mudjacking, but it cures faster and puts less weight on the soil underneath. Foam leveling costs slightly more upfront than mudjacking but cures faster and may last longer.

What to Look for in a Commercial Slab Leveling Contractor

Verify Credentials

Before hiring any commercial slab leveling contractor in Alpine, confirm they carry general liability insurance and meet local licensing requirements. Ask for proof. Reputable contractors won't hesitate to show it.

Understand What You're Paying For

Request an itemized estimate that breaks down labor, materials, and any additional charges like mobilization or patching. This makes it easier to compare bids from different contractors.

Ask About Previous Work

Ask if the contractor has photos of recent commercial slab leveling projects similar to yours. Before-and-after images give you a realistic sense of what to expect. References from Alpine homeowners are even better.

Warranty Details

Not all warranties are equal. Some cover only the leveling work, while others include the injected material and soil stabilization. Ask what happens if the slab settles again within the warranty period.
